Wouldn't google think your trying to google bomb, if you had your site's url in your sig, and had about 400 post's on a forum?

Typically Google is pretty good about detecting that situation. Several links going to one location from one site. This would be the same as someone putting a link thousands of times on one page. From what I understand this doesn't figure into PageRank as much as you would think. The formula itself is said to have over 700 different variables for determining value of a page.

The value of a page is more built on which sites reference your site, not how many times they reference your site. 1000 mentions or 1 mention, same value usually.
